Abstract

1. This design consists of one module and is intended for use in special operations; the mini-hangar is designed with eight angled joints for enhanced stability; the system has an inflatable floor and can be air-filled from only two valves; the structure is secured to the ground using ground anchors (stakes) and tension straps.; 2. This design consists of 2-meter by 2-meter modules connected using zippers; the hangar is designed with 8 angled joints for enhanced stability; the lower section of the walls has a 90-degree vertical angle with a height of 2,5 to 5 meters; the structure is secured to the ground using ground anchors (stakes) and tension straps.; 3. Tube hangar module consisting of 5-meter by 5-meter modules that are connected using zippers; the hangar is designed with 8 angled joints for enhanced stability; the system is a tube system movable by wheel; the lower section of the walls has a 90-degree vertical angle on from 3-5 meters; the structure is secured to the ground using ground anchors (stakes) and tension straps.; 4. This design consists of 2-meter by 2-meter modules that are connected using zippers; the structure is secured to the ground using ground anchors (stakes) and tension straps.; 5. This design consists of a module; the structure is secured to the ground using ground anchors (stakes) and tension straps.; 6. Constructed with reinforced PVC tubing and steel wire for enhanced strength being portable and lightweight, easy to transport and deploy in various conditions with high load capacity and using DWF technology and robust design to support significant weight and for fast inflation and secure setup.
